Since 2003, Zarea has been a leading player in the zoological industry, specializing in the production of natural chews and treats for dogs. Located in Łąg, a picturesque town nestled in the heart of the Bory Tucholskie forest, in the northern part of Poland's Pomerania region, our company has witnessed tremendous growth and success.

Our journey initially began with the production of pork ear chews for dogs. However, as we strived for excellence, we quickly expanded our product range to include beef and poultry treats, catering to the diverse preferences and dietary needs of our canine companions.

We take pride in our commitment to upholding the highest standards of quality and safety. This commitment is epitomized by the implementation of renowned quality systems such as HACCP (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points), GMP (Good Manufacturing Practices), and GHP (Good Hygiene Practices). These systems ensure that our products consistently meet stringent industry standards, providing peace of mind to both pet owners and professionals.

Over the years, our relentless pursuit of continuous improvement and accumulated experience has helped us carve out a prominent position in the market. As a testament to our success, we have significantly increased our production capacity, allowing us to meet the growing demands of our valued clients.

While we take pride in serving our domestic market, we are equally thrilled to have gained the trust of numerous international clients. In fact, a remarkable 95% of our production is exported to Western markets, thanks to our reliable partnerships and cooperation with esteemed companies.
